Metformin is one of the most widely prescribed medications for managing type 2 diabetes, lauded for its effectiveness in lowering blood sugar levels [1.5.1]. It primarily works by reducing the amount of glucose produced by the liver and improving insulin sensitivity in the body's tissues. While millions of people tolerate it well, a subset of users experiences side effects. Among the most common are gastrointestinal issues like diarrhea and nausea, but headaches are also a reported concern [1.8.6, 1.3.1]. For those affected, the persistent pain can be unsettling. Understanding the underlying pharmacological reasons for these headaches is the first step toward managing them effectively and ensuring continued, comfortable treatment.
The Primary Mechanisms: Why Does Metformin Cause Headaches?
The onset of headaches when starting or taking metformin isn't due to a single cause but rather a combination of physiological adjustments and potential secondary effects. The body must adapt to the new metabolic environment created by the medication.
Changes in Blood Glucose Levels
One of the most direct reasons for headaches is the body's reaction to altered glucose levels [1.2.1]. Metformin's core function is to lower high blood sugar. As your body, which has become accustomed to higher glucose concentrations, adjusts to this new, lower baseline, headaches can occur [1.6.2]. This is often a temporary side effect that subsides as your system stabilizes.
Furthermore, while metformin on its own rarely causes hypoglycemia (dangerously low blood sugar), the risk increases when it's taken in combination with other diabetes medications like sulfonylureas or insulin [1.6.1, 1.8.5]. Hypoglycemia is a well-known trigger for headaches, often accompanied by symptoms like shakiness, dizziness, and sweating [1.6.5, 1.8.4]. If you experience headaches along with these symptoms, it's crucial to check your blood glucose levels [1.7.1].
Vitamin B12 Deficiency
A significant long-term consideration is metformin's impact on Vitamin B12 absorption. Studies have shown that prolonged use of metformin can interfere with the calcium-dependent absorption of the B12-intrinsic factor complex in the terminal ileum, leading to a deficiency [1.5.1, 1.5.3]. Vitamin B12 is crucial for healthy nerve function, and a deficiency can manifest as a range of neurological symptoms, including peripheral neuropathy (numbness or tingling in hands and feet), dizziness, cognitive disturbances, and fatigue [1.5.4, 1.5.6]. While headache is not the most common symptom, neurological changes and associated conditions like anemia caused by B12 deficiency can contribute to feeling unwell and experiencing head pain [1.8.6]. This effect is more common than previously thought, and monitoring B12 levels is now recommended for long-term users [1.5.3].
Vascular and Inflammatory Pathways
Emerging research points to other, more complex mechanisms. One theory suggests that metformin may increase the production of nitric oxide (NO) [1.2.2]. Nitric oxide is a vasodilator, meaning it widens blood vessels. This cerebral vasodilation is a known mechanism for triggering headaches, including migraines, in susceptible individuals [1.2.2]. By reducing levels of asymmetric dimethylarginine (ADMA), metformin can enhance NO synthesis, potentially leading to this vascular side effect [1.2.2]. Additionally, some research suggests metformin has a direct effect on inflammation, which is a major component in the development of migraines, though ironically it is also being studied as a potential preventative treatment for this reason [1.2.3, 1.2.4].
Lactic Acidosis: A Rare but Serious Consideration
It is impossible to discuss metformin's side effects without addressing lactic acidosis. This is a very rare but life-threatening condition that carries an FDA black box warning—the most serious type of warning [1.4.6, 1.8.6]. It occurs when lactic acid builds up in the bloodstream faster than it can be removed, often because of a coexisting condition like severe kidney or liver disease, which impairs metformin clearance from the body [1.8.1, 1.8.4].
Symptoms are often described as severe and vague, including extreme tiredness, muscle pain, trouble breathing, stomach pain, feeling cold, dizziness, and a slow or irregular heartbeat [1.4.4, 1.8.6]. While headache can be a less common symptom of the general malaise associated with lactic acidosis, the primary symptoms are much more severe and warrant immediate medical attention [1.4.3, 1.4.1].
Comparison of Metformin Side Effects
It's important to distinguish between common, manageable side effects and rare, serious ones.
Side Effect Type | Examples | Frequency | What to Do |
---|---|---|---|
Common | Diarrhea, nausea, gas, stomach upset, metallic taste, headache [1.8.6, 1.3.4] | Up to 30% of users experience GI effects; headaches are less common (e.g., ~4.4%) [1.3.4, 1.3.1]. | Usually temporary. Take with food, stay hydrated. Consult a doctor if persistent [1.7.2, 1.2.1]. |
Long-Term | Vitamin B12 Deficiency [1.5.3] | Risk increases with long-term use [1.8.2]. | Ask your doctor to monitor B12 levels; supplementation may be needed [1.8.4]. |
Rare but Serious | Lactic Acidosis [1.8.6] | Very rare [1.8.1]. | Medical emergency. Seek immediate medical attention if you experience symptoms like severe muscle pain, difficulty breathing, or extreme fatigue [1.4.6]. |
Rare | Hypoglycemia (low blood sugar) [1.8.5] | Rare when metformin is used alone; risk increases with other diabetes drugs [1.6.1, 1.6.3]. | Check blood sugar. Treat with a fast-acting sugar source. Talk to your doctor about medication adjustments [1.7.1]. |
Strategies for Managing Metformin-Related Headaches
If you are experiencing headaches from metformin, several strategies can help minimize or eliminate them. Always discuss these with your healthcare provider before making changes.
- Start Low, Increase Slowly: Doctors typically initiate metformin at a low dose and gradually increase it over several weeks. This allows the body to adjust and can significantly reduce the incidence of side effects, including headaches [1.7.2, 1.8.1].
- Take Metformin with a Meal: Taking your dose with food is one of the most effective ways to buffer against side effects, particularly gastrointestinal issues, which can sometimes contribute to feeling unwell and developing headaches [1.7.2, 1.8.2].
- Switch to Extended-Release (ER): The extended-release version of metformin releases the drug more slowly into your system. This gentler absorption often leads to fewer and milder side effects. Studies show a significant reduction in GI issues, and it may also help with headaches [1.8.2, 1.7.2].
- Stay Hydrated and Maintain a Stable Diet: Drinking plenty of water and eating a balanced diet can help your body manage blood sugar changes more effectively, potentially reducing headache triggers [1.7.6, 1.2.7]. Avoid large sugar spikes, which can also cause headaches [1.2.7].
- Monitor Vitamin B12: If you've been on metformin for several years, ask your doctor to check your vitamin B12 levels [1.8.4]. If a deficiency is detected, a simple supplement can often resolve associated neurological symptoms.
Conclusion
While metformin is a cornerstone of diabetes management, the headaches it can cause are a real and disruptive side effect for some. In most cases, they are a temporary part of the body's adjustment to better blood sugar control. However, they can also be a sign of manageable issues like hypoglycemia or a developing vitamin B12 deficiency. By understanding the potential causes and working with a healthcare provider to implement management strategies—such as dose titration, switching to an ER formula, and monitoring nutrient levels—most patients can continue to benefit from this important medication without compromising their quality of life. If headaches are severe or persistent, medical consultation is essential to rule out other causes and find the best path forward.
